How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hillsboro?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hillsboro Studio Apartments | $1,145 | $700 | $1,395 |
| Hillsboro 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,034 | $486 | $1,895 |
| Hillsboro 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,319 | $527 | $2,809 |
| Hillsboro 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,572 | $587 | $3,219 |
| Hillsboro 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,590 | $600 | $3,110 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Hillsboro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Hillsboro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Hillsboro is $1,347.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Hillsboro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Hillsboro is a 1,900 square feet unit starting from $1,569 at ReNew Edwardsville Apartment Collection.
What is the average size for Hillsboro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Hillsboro is currently at 820 sq ft.
